Le Couvent des Minimes Eau Sereine Hand Cream ~ scented body product review

Posted by Jessica on 28 April 2016 2 Comments

Le Couvent des Minimes Eau Sereine Hand Cream

It’s been a hectic month or so at my “day job.” My workplace was temporarily topsy-turvy due to rush deadlines and personnel changes, major annual events, unexpected VIP visits and technical difficulties. I was getting home later and later at night, often with a headache — and I’m a just one small wheel in the organizational machinery, so I know the situation was even more stressful for many of my coworkers.

I had some chemical assistance on stressful days, at least, and I don’t mean pharmaceuticals or even a stiff drink. Instead, I relied on Enfleurage’s Sanctuary oil, and a new hand cream from Le Couvent des Minimes with a scent named (appropriately) Eau Sereine…

Majda Bekkali Tulaytulah ~ new fragrance

Posted by Robin on 28 April 2016 6 Comments

Majda Bekkali Tulaytulah

French niche line Majda Bekkali has launched Tulaytulah, a new unisex fragrance named for the Spanish city of Toledo (called Tulaytulah under Arab rule) and intended as message of peace and hope…
